It is with sadness that we announce the death of Idell Roller Lesmeister, a beloved mother, grandmother, and devoted member of her community, on October 2, 2024, in Minot, ND at the age of 89.
Funeral services will be at 10:30 a.m. on Monday, October 7, 2024, at St. Cecilia Catholic Church, Harvey, ND with visitation being from 4 p.m. to 6 p.m. Sunday at Hertz Funeral Home Burial will be in the church cemetery.
Idell was born on December 22, 1934, in a small house in Hurdsfield, ND, to Leo Roller and Ida Hirschkorn Roller. She spent her early years in North Dakota, attending school in Harvey, where she made lifelong friends and laid the foundation for a life filled with love, family, and faith.
In 1952, Idell married Clarence Eugene "C.E." Lesmeister. Together, they built a life on a farm west of Selz, where they lived until 1981, before moving to Harvey. Clarence died in 2006.
A woman deeply rooted in her faith, Idell was active in her church and community. She was a proud member of the Catholic Daughters, an organization that reflected her devotion to helping others and serving with grace. Whether socializing with friends, bowling with her league, or playing joyfully in the St. Cecilia Bell Choir, Idell brought light and joy to those around her.
In her later years, Idell married Don Weninger and they resided in Harvey.
Idell's greatest joy, however, came from her family. She is survived by her husband, Don Weninger and her five children: Debra (Mark) Dockter, Kent (Candice), Denise (Lon) Wurz, Dean, and Cory (Rebecca). She also leaves behind 10 grandchildren and 11 great-grandchildren, each carrying a piece of her kindness and strength in their hearts. Idell was preceded in death by her parents; husband, Clarence; brothers, Leo Roller Jr. and Arlie Roller; sister, Alice Undem.
Though Idell has left us, the love she shared, the faith she lived, and the joy she brought to the world will remain forever in the hearts of all who were blessed to know her.
